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technicians ar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age, identify the source of the leak, and develop a plan to fix it. We’ll explain the process and timeline to you, so you know what to expect.
Step 2: Water Removal and Cleanup
We use advanced equipment such as submersible pumps and wet vacuums, to remove standing water and damaged materials. Our team will also cl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ers will be used to dry out the affected area, ensuring that your property is completely dry and free from moisture.
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ction
Our skilled technicians will repair or replace any damaged materials, including walls, ceilings, and floors. We’ll also ensure that your plumbing system is functioning properly.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
We’ll inspect your property to ensure that everything is in working order, and our team will leave your home clean and tidy.

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al Cost In College Grove, TN
The cost of tree root pipe damage water removal in College Grove, TN,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age and the required repairs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Removal and Cleanup | $500-$2,000 | Size of affected area and amount of water |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$300-$1,500 | Duration of drying process and equipment needed |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$1,000-$5,000 | Extent of damage and materials needed |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$200-$1,000 | Scope of the cleanup and quality of work |

What Causes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al?
Tree roots can infiltrate your pipes, causing them to leak and leading to water damage. Aging pipes, poor maintenance, and improper installation can also contribute to the issue.
